  • Patent number: 9955328
    Abstract: A device automatically is configured to the emergency alert system (EAS) channel utilized by the location from which the device registers with a network. In an example configuration, an EAS server provides a mobile switching center (MSC) configuration information regarding the emergency alert channels to be used for the cellular sites supported by the MSC. When the mobile device registers via a cellular site supported by the MSC, the designated channel to be used for EAS messages is sent to the mobile device as part of the registration process. The mobile device assigns an internal channel to the designated channel. In another example configuration, the mobile device is preconfigured with a table listing all possible EAS channels, and the MSC provides, during the registration process, a pointer to the appropriate portion of the table.

  • Patent number: 9877150
    Abstract: A subscriber of the Emergency Alert System (EAS) receiving an EAS alert message can obtain additional multimedia information in based upon the location of the subscriber. The additional multimedia information can include information pertaining to available shelter, medical facilities, the location of emergency supplies, a plume map, evacuation routes, or the like. In an example embodiment, the Global Positioning System or other device location systems is utilized to determine the location of the subscriber. The location information along with EAS alert information is used to query a database to obtain the additional information.

  • Patent number: 9866879
    Abstract: Architecture for the delivery of IP-based messages from wired and/or wireless devices to a television system. The means for delivery can be via an Internet Protocol Television (IPTV) technology. The message is processed through a messaging system that obtains a mapping of a message address to an IPTV address, and routes the message to an IPTV network for delivery the desired television system for presentation. Messaging can be via SMS (short message service) for textual content, MMS (multimedia messaging service) for multimedia content, or other messaging technologies, such as instant messaging, an e-mail, for example. Optionally, the message from the user device can include a request for confirmation of delivery of the message to the television. The confirmation can then be routed back over an IP data network to the user device and presented to the user.

  • Publication number: 20170127261
    Abstract: A call to an emergency call center from a device is initiated utilizing a relay service. The device may send a non-voice message to the relay service. The relay service, upon receipt and analysis of the message, may initiate a call to the device. The device, upon receiving the call and determining that the call is from the relay service, may place the call on hold and initiate a call to an emergency call center. Subsequently, the device may establish a multi-party call between the device, the relay service, and the emergency call center. Further, the relay service may maintain multiple communications modes in order to conduct non-voice messages with the device and conduct voice communications with the emergency call center.
